Mesothelioma Attorneys

Mesothelioma lawyers help asbestos victims and their families to receive compensation for their loss. They are renowned for getting large settlements and verdicts.

They can make lawsuits or trust fund claims, or VA claims on behalf of their clients. They also assist patients in identifying potential sources of exposure. They may be eligible for compensation for funeral costs, medical bills, loss of income, and pain and discomfort.

They've got experience

mesothelioma settlement lawyers and their companies have extensive experience fighting for compensation for asbestos victims and their families. They can review claims, file suits and assist clients throughout the legal process.

Asbestos-related victims must be compensated for medical expenses, lost wages and other financial losses. Attorneys are able to calculate damages for both economic losses and non-economic damages like suffering and pain. They can also assist patients in getting financial compensation through asbestos trust funds as well as wrongful death claims.

Lawyers with expertise in mesothelioma cases are well-versed in the industries, products, and high-risk professions connected to asbestos exposure. They can assist in identifying possible sources of exposure and connect them with mesothelioma treatment centers. They can also file lawsuits against businesses that exposed their clients to asbestos, and hold them responsible for the harm caused.

Many states have a statute or a time limit within which an individual must file a legal suit to be able to receive compensation for mesothelioma. The time frame varies by state, but the majority of mesothelioma lawsuits have to be filed within one to three years from diagnosis.

A mesothelioma lawyer with experience is vital. The process of bringing a lawsuit can be complicated and time consuming. A lawyer or law firm should have a successful track record and a solid understanding of state and federal laws that govern asbestos litigation.

A mesothelioma lawyer must be familiar with asbestos companies that are accountable for exposure, as well as their corporate business culture and practices. This will help them build a strong case for their client and ensure they get the best possible outcome.

Asbestos attorneys are aware that asbestos-related mesothelioma diseases can affect every aspect of the life of a person. This can make it difficult to assess the total worth of a claim by a victim. They have the knowledge and skills to assess their client's case and secure the most lucrative award.

Some of the top mesothelioma law firms in nation have decades of experience representing asbestos patients and their families. They have secured billions of dollars in settlements and verdicts in jury trials for clients, including New Yorkers.

They charge contingency fees

Most mesothelioma lawyers are on a contingency basis. They only get paid if their client is awarded compensation. This is a huge benefit for mesothelioma victims since it guarantees that they will not have to pay an upfront cost to hire a lawyer.

It is advisable to inquire about the cost of the attorney before hiring them. Many lawyers charge hourly which can add up quickly in the event of a case going to trial. Additionally, some firms advertise that they have years of expertise in handling mesothelioma cases however they do not actually take the cases themselves. They refer the case to another firm in exchange for a part of the attorney's fee.

Mesothelioma patients are often struggling to pay for treatment and this is why it's vital that they work with a qualified attorney. The expertise and resources of a lawyer can make the whole process simpler. They can also help you receive compensation and benefits through asbestos trust funds. These funds are created to pay mesothelioma patients for medical expenses loss of income, as well as other financial losses.

Top mesothelioma lawyers combine legal expertise with compassion for their clients. They understand the way a mesothelioma diagnosis could affect a person as well as their loved ones, which is why they try to make the legal process as easy as possible. This allows patients to concentrate on their health and spend more time with their family members.

In general, patients with mesothelioma are compensated between $1 and $1.4 million. A jury verdict could result in higher payouts.

Veterans may also be eligible for compensation for mesothelioma by filing a suit with the Department of Veterans Affairs. People with mesothelioma are eligible for financial assistance, including monthly payments and free or low-cost medical treatment. Attorneys can help veterans determine which trust funds they should submit claims to and also file VA claim forms on their behalf. Patients with mesothelioma should consult with an attorney who has a military background and is well-versed in VA benefits.
